 The Smith & Wesson Model 1 ½ was introduced as the company’s second .32-caliber tip-up revolver, designed to bridge the gap between the small .22-caliber Model 1 and the larger .32-caliber Model 2. Chambered for the .32 rimfire cartridge, it featured a five-shot cylinder and single-action firing system — typical of early cartridge revolvers as manufacturers transitioned away from percussion cap and ball designs to self-contained metallic cartridges.
A 2nd Issue – fluted barrel & cylinder, rounded “birds-head” grip; more refined styling (1868–1875.  
This revolver— fluted barrel and rounded grip with a spur trigger — fits squarely into the 2nd Issue category produced as a tip-up .32 rimfire model.
